Data: Hyperliquid has accumulated $55.4 million in fees since May
According to ChainCatcher, monitored by on-chain analyst Ai Yi, the decentralized perpetual contract trading platform Hyperliquid set a new single-day fee record since 2025 on May 21, reaching $4.65 million. The platform has accumulated $55.4 million in fees since May.
